Monthly Cost of Living

Monthly costs for one person with rent: $593 in Kelibia versus $621 in Sfax.

Estimated couple costs with rent: $938 in Kelibia versus $984 in Sfax.

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$1,282 in Kelibia versus $1,347 in Sfax.

Living in Kelibia costs roughly 4% less than in Sfax, driven mainly by Sport & Entertainment.

Both cities sit below the global median: Kelibia 56% lower, Sfax 54% lower.

Cost Breakdown

A one-bedroom apartment in the center runs $198 in Kelibia and $190 in Sfax. Housing cost is often the main lever when comparing two cities.

Sfax pays 36% more on average. The extra income cushions the higher costs, though housing choices and lifestyle decide how much of the gap is truly closed.

Dining out: $14.00 in Kelibia vs $20.00 in Sfax for a mid-range dinner for two. Groceries echo the gap at $178 vs $189 per month, with Kelibia cheaper across the board.
